Surrealism. Surrealism and American Art, 1931–1947 by Jeffrey Wechsler. Exhibition catalog. Annuals It tracks the physical progressionRutgers University Art Gallery, 1977. Wraps, near fine with a few small indentations on rear cover. 116 pages. 158 catalog illustrations, plus small text illustrations, most in black and white with a few in color. Includes art in a wide variety of media, including photography. Chapter on photography and surrealism. Photographers include George Platt Lynes, David Hare, and Clarence John Laughlin. LC Catalog No. 76 620092. Not issued with ISBN number.
